Donald Trump has warned Florida's Governor Ron DeSantis against running for president in 2024, saying doing so would harm the Republican Party. He also threatened to release unflattering information about the 44-year-old, without providing details. Mr DeSantis won a landslide victory in Tuesday's midterms, underlining his popularity and further fuelling speculation he will launch a bid. Mr Trump is also tipped to announce a presidential run in the coming days. He told US network Fox News that the Florida governor should stay out of the race. "I don't know if he is running. I think if he runs, he could hurt himself very badly. I really believe he could hurt himself badly," Mr Trump said. "I don't think it would be good for the party." Mr DeSantis is considered by many to be the most likely candidate to supplant Mr Trump as the Republican candidate to run for president in 2024. https://www.bbc.co.uk/news/world-us-canada-63563862 |

DeSantis takes every chance to hammer home the idea of Florida as the “nation’s citadel of freedom,” as he put it in a campaign stump speech in Melbourne last week. That allows him to champion his own state against a range of opponents defined by geography and referenced by name: crime- ridden blue cities such as San Francisco, the piously pro-immigration liberals of Martha’s Vineyard, the “elites” in Washington, D.C. In the governor’s narrative of the coronavirus, the people of Florida did not ower at home or tentatively venture outside in masks, nor did they labor under vaccine mandates as new variants spread across the country. No, they ere free. Free to support their family. Free to attend school. Free to run a usiness.
